1. Explore Gangtok’s MG Marg
The heart of Sikkim’s capital, MG Marg, is a vibrant street lined with cafes, shops, and restaurants. Enjoy a leisurely stroll while soaking in the city's energetic atmosphere.
2. Witness the Tranquility of Tsomgo Lake
Tsomgo Lake, also known as Changu Lake, is a mesmerizing glacial lake surrounded by snow-capped peaks. Visiting during summer offers a completely different experience compared to the frozen winter months.
3. Visit the Nathula Pass
A visit to the Indo-China border at Nathula Pass is an experience like no other. The breathtaking views and historical significance make it a must-visit.
4. Discover the Spirituality of Rumtek Monastery
One of Sikkim’s most significant Buddhist monasteries, Rumtek Monastery, is a peaceful retreat with stunning architecture and spiritual significance.
5. Trek to Goecha La
For adventure lovers, the Goecha La trek offers unparalleled views of Kanchenjunga, the third-highest mountain in the world.
6. Experience the Serenity of Yumthang Valley
Also known as the ‘Valley of Flowers,’ Yumthang Valley is a riot of colors in spring, making it a top attraction in any summer tour packages.
7. Enjoy the Hot Springs of Yume Samdong
Located near Yumthang Valley, Yume Samdong is famous for its natural hot springs believed to have medicinal properties.
8. Marvel at the Beauty of Gurudongmar Lake
Situated at an altitude of 17,800 feet, Gurudongmar Lake is one of the highest lakes in the world, offering a surreal experience.
9. Explore the Caves of Sikkim
For adventure seekers, Sikkim’s sacred caves like the North Lha-ri-nying Phu offer an exciting exploration opportunity.
10. Ride the Cable Car in Gangtok
The Gangtok Ropeway provides panoramic views of the city and the surrounding mountains, making it a popular tourist attraction.
11. Visit the Namgyal Institute of Tibetology
This institute is a treasure trove of Tibetan Buddhist culture, housing rare artifacts and manuscripts.
12. Take a Yak Ride at Tsomgo Lake
Experience the thrill of riding a yak along the scenic shores of Tsomgo Lake for a truly unique adventure.
13. Admire the Views from Tashi Viewpoint
Tashi Viewpoint offers mesmerizing sunrise and sunset views over the Kanchenjunga mountain range.
14. Explore the Beautiful Lachung Village
Lachung, with its apple orchards, waterfalls, and monasteries, is a picturesque village perfect for a peaceful retreat.
15. Visit the Seven Sisters Waterfall
This stunning waterfall along the way to North Sikkim is a great spot for photography and relaxation.
16. Discover the Rich Culture of Zuluk
The winding roads of Zuluk, part of the Old Silk Route, offer breathtaking views and a chance to experience local culture.
17. Witness the Snow-Clad Beauty of Lachen
Lachen is a charming mountain village that serves as a base for exploring Gurudongmar Lake and Chopta Valley.
18. Attend a Local Festival
Sikkim’s festivals, such as Losar and Pang Lhabsol, offer a vibrant glimpse into the state's rich cultural traditions.
19. Relish Sikkimese Cuisine
Indulge in delicious local dishes like momos, thukpa, and phagshapa while exploring the region.
20. Visit the Buddha Park in Ravangla
This park features a giant Buddha statue against the backdrop of the stunning Himalayan mountains.
21. Take a River Rafting Adventure in Teesta River
For thrill-seekers, white-water rafting in the Teesta River is an exhilarating experience.
22. Explore Pemayangtse Monastery
One of Sikkim’s oldest monasteries, Pemayangtse Monastery, offers a deep dive into Buddhist history and architecture.
23. Walk on the Skywalk in Pelling
The glass-floored Skywalk in Pelling provides an adrenaline rush along with breathtaking views of the Himalayas.
24. Go Paragliding in Gangtok
Experience the thrill of flying over the lush valleys of Sikkim with a paragliding adventure in Gangtok.
25. Relax in the Scenic Beauty of Ravangla
Ravangla, a quaint town, is perfect for unwinding amidst nature’s tranquility and enjoying mesmerizing Himalayan vistas.
